Output 427ae03604688e20dfd53f36db4bcaf7b30f165256efc8e069d2a27da306c42e:0

value
1492094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ca2e51b4cfa5799ad7637e676ee42657af9f66ec OP_EQUAL
address
3L83uc5DVzeVq9ZJtVthm2oVpfqN3ZMzWq
transaction
427ae03604688e20dfd53f36db4bcaf7b30f165256efc8e069d2a27da306c42e